ENGINE INSTALLATION AFTER
CYLINDER HEAD REPAIR
1.
Install new oil filter, engine oil and primary chaincase
fluid as necessary. See Section 1.
2.
Install throttle body and manifold and support bracket.

WARNING
WARNING
Always connect positive battery cable first. If the positive
cable should contact ground with the negative cable
installed, the resulting sparks may cause a battery explo-
sion which could result in death or serious injury.
7.
Install battery. Connect both battery cables, positive
cable first.
